Cabri 3D Interactive Geometry
Explore Solid Geometry with Cabri 3D

Cabri 3D is interactive solid geometry software. Using Cabri 3D, in a few clicks, you can construct and manipulate the following solid geometry objects:-

Dynamically transform your construction to reveal relationships between the elements.

Clarify and organise your construction using the numerous graphic attributes available (colours, textures, styles).

Freely move the viewpoint around your construction, and simultaneously display any number of projections (from a choice of over 15 standard projections).

Organise these views on one or more pages, adding comments (rich text).

Print or capture document pages at high resolution.Export your documents as interactively manipulable figures for inclusion in Windows applications and web pages (free Windows plugin).

By reverse-engineering the protocol used for Xbox-to-Windows streaming, the developers created a standalone client that allowed Mac users to connect to their Xbox One or Xbox Series X/S consoles. This was not merely a novelty; it was a functional solution for a demographic ignored by the first-party manufacturer. It highlighted a disconnect between hardware manufacturers and consumer desire: while corporations often use exclusive software to drive hardware sales (i.e., buying a PC to use Xbox features), third-party developers like OneCast prioritized user accessibility over ecosystem loyalty.

Despite its ingenuity, OneCast has never been an official Microsoft product, and this status imposes inherent risks. Apple’s App Store guidelines have historically restricted applications that function as remote desktop or gaming clients unless they comply with strict rules. OneCast circumvented some hurdles by initially distributing via direct download for Mac and TestFlight for iOS, later securing a permanent App Store presence. More critically, Microsoft occasionally updates its Xbox authentication protocols or streaming APIs, which can temporarily break third-party clients. OneCast’s developer has been diligent about updates, but each patch reminds users that the application exists at the pleasure of Microsoft’s undocumented goodwill. onecast

Construct and manipulate

While constructing, already built objects can be constantly manipulated, and the projection of the current view updated. Object selection can be made in any view. The implicit mechanism of object creation considerably simplifies the construction of the figures. A point of intersection between a line and a plan in a construction can thus be used without having to create in advance.
Many graphic attributes (colour, size, texture) can be applied to objects to create even more attractive and comprehensible figures.

CabriML and Web figures

The Cabri 3D files format is based on the XML standard (CabriML), so that any user may understand and modify Cabri 3D files. Combined with the internal use of the Unicode standard for the representation of the characters, Cabri 3D can be used to create and read figures in all languages.
The Cabri 3D plug-in allows dynamic geometry figures to be published on the Internet, and also in other word processing documents.

Becta BETT Awards 2007 Winner: " Cabri 3D is a 3D visualisation tool that allows secondary school students to explore the properties of 3D space and solid geometry with mathematical rigour. The product is closely aligned to the shape, space and measures aspect of the Maths National Curriculum. Students can quickly create and manipulate shapes in creative ways that would be impossible to replicate with solid objects. "
